游戏开发者AI配音初探:Whisper语音识别技术实践
2025.09.23 12:26浏览量:0简介:本文聚焦游戏开发者如何利用Whisper语音识别模型实现AI配音,从技术原理、应用场景、实践案例到优化建议,为游戏人提供从入门到进阶的完整指南。
游戏开发者AI配音初探:Whisper语音识别技术实践
一、游戏配音的AI化转型背景
在游戏开发中,配音是塑造角色性格、增强沉浸感的核心环节。传统配音流程需经历演员试音、录音棚录制、后期剪辑等环节,存在成本高、周期长、修改困难等痛点。随着AI语音技术的突破,游戏开发者开始探索用AI生成配音的可能性,而Whisper语音识别模型凭借其高精度、多语言支持等特性,成为游戏配音AI化的重要工具。
1.1 传统配音的局限性
- 成本问题:专业配音演员单句报价可达数百元,大型游戏角色配音成本可能超百万元。
- 时间成本:从试音到最终交付通常需数周,紧急需求难以满足。
- 修改难度:若需调整台词或语气,需重新录制,增加沟通成本。
- 语言障碍:多语言版本需分别配音,全球化项目成本指数级增长。
1.2 AI配音的技术优势
- 成本降低:单角色配音成本可降至传统方式的1/10。
- 效率提升:实时生成配音,修改仅需调整文本。
- 多语言支持:Whisper支持99种语言,可一键生成多语言配音。
- 风格定制:通过调整语速、音调、情感参数,实现个性化配音。
二、Whisper语音识别模型解析
Whisper是由OpenAI开发的开源语音识别模型,其核心优势在于高精度、多语言支持和抗噪声能力,使其成为游戏配音的理想选择。
2.1 Whisper的技术原理
Whisper采用Transformer架构,通过大规模多语言语音数据训练,实现了对语音的高精度转录。其关键特性包括:
- 多语言支持:支持99种语言,包括方言和低资源语言。
- 抗噪声能力:在背景噪声、口音、语速变化等场景下仍保持高准确率。
- 端到端识别:直接输出文本,无需传统ASR系统的声学模型和语言模型分离设计。
2.2 Whisper在游戏配音中的应用场景
- 角色对话生成:根据剧本文本生成角色语音。
- 旁白配音:快速生成游戏剧情旁白。
- 多语言版本:一键生成多语言配音,降低全球化成本。
- 动态对话系统:结合NLP技术,实现玩家输入的实时语音响应。
三、游戏开发者实践指南:从入门到进阶
3.1 基础实践:使用Whisper进行语音转文本
步骤1:环境准备
# 安装Whisperpip install openai-whisper# 下载模型(以base模型为例)wget https://openaipublic.blob.core.windows.net/main/whisper/models/base.en.pt
步骤2:语音转文本
import whisper# 加载模型model = whisper.load_model("base.en.pt")# 语音转文本result = model.transcribe("game_dialogue.wav", language="zh", task="transcribe")print(result["text"])
关键参数说明:
language:指定语言(如zh为中文)。task:transcribe(转录)或translate(翻译)。
3.2 进阶实践:结合TTS生成AI配音
Whisper本身不包含语音合成功能,但可与TTS(Text-to-Speech)模型结合实现完整配音流程。
步骤1:选择TTS模型
推荐使用以下开源TTS模型:
- VITS:支持多语言、情感控制。
- FastSpeech 2:高效率、低延迟。
- Microsoft TTS API(非开源):商业级质量,需付费。
步骤2:实现端到端配音
import whisperfrom vits import Synthesizer # 假设使用VITS# 语音转文本model = whisper.load_model("base")result = model.transcribe("dialogue.wav", language="zh")# 文本转语音synthesizer = Synthesizer("vits_model_path")audio = synthesizer.synthesize(result["text"], speaker_id=0, emotion="happy")# 保存音频import soundfile as sfsf.write("output.wav", audio, 22050)
3.3 优化建议:提升配音质量
- 数据增强:对原始语音进行降噪、变速处理,提升Whisper识别准确率。
- 风格控制:在TTS阶段通过调整
emotion、speed等参数,匹配角色性格。 - 后处理:使用Audacity等工具调整音量、均衡器,优化最终音质。
四、案例分析:某游戏公司的AI配音实践
4.1 项目背景
某中型游戏公司开发一款多语言RPG游戏,传统配音成本达200万元,周期6个月。
4.2 AI配音方案
- 工具选择:Whisper(语音识别)+ VITS(语音合成)。
- 流程优化:
- 剧本撰写后直接生成中文配音。
- 通过Whisper翻译功能生成英文、日文等版本。
- 使用VITS合成多语言语音。
- 成本对比:
- AI方案成本:20万元(模型训练+人力)。
- 周期缩短至2个月。
4.3 效果评估
- 质量:玩家测试显示,AI配音在情感表达上达专业演员的80%。
- 反馈:90%玩家未察觉配音为AI生成。
五、未来展望:AI配音的技术趋势
- 情感生成:结合情感计算模型,实现更自然的语音表达。
- 实时交互:低延迟TTS技术支撑动态对话系统。
- 个性化定制:基于玩家偏好生成专属配音风格。
六、结语:AI配音的机遇与挑战
Whisper语音识别模型为游戏开发者提供了高效、低成本的配音解决方案,但其成功应用需结合TTS技术、后处理优化及持续迭代。未来,随着AI语音技术的进步,AI配音有望成为游戏开发的标准配置,推动行业向更高效、更个性化的方向发展。
实践建议:
- 从小规模测试开始:先在非核心角色上试用AI配音,逐步扩大应用范围。
- 关注模型更新:Whisper等开源模型持续迭代,及时跟进最新版本。
- 建立质量评估体系:通过AB测试对比AI与人工配音效果,持续优化流程。
通过合理应用Whisper语音识别技术,游戏开发者可在保证质量的前提下,显著降低配音成本,提升开发效率,为玩家带来更丰富的游戏体验。

发表评论
登录后可评论,请前往 登录 或 注册